DENVER (AP) - Timmy Smith, who set a Super Bowl rushing record when he played for the Washington Redskins in 1988, has been arrested after allegedly trying to sell cocaine to an undercover drug agent.
Smith, 41, of Denver and his brother, Chris, of suburban Lakewood, were in custody and due in court Monday, U.S. attorney's spokesman Jeff Dorschner said Friday. They could face charges of conspiracy to possess with intent to distribute more than 500 grams of cocaine.
Bond had not been set and it was unclear if they had lawyers by early Friday evening.
"It doesn't matter how famous you are, what sport you play or what records you hold," said Jeffrey D. Sweetin, special agent in charge of the Drug Enforcement Administration's Rocky Mountain Division. "The American people will not tolerate such disregard for the law, and neither will the DEA."
